储存数据
cc.sys.localStorage.setItem(key, value)
//储存复杂的数据,可以将数据转成json
let userData = {
name: 'Tracer',
level: 1,
gold: 100
};
cc.sys.localStorage.setItem('userData', JSON.stringify(userData));
读取数据
cc.sys.localStorage.getItem(key)
//读取复杂数据,将json再转回object
let fromJson = cc.sys.localStorage.getItem(key)
JSON.parse(fromJson)
移除键值对
//当我们不再需要一个存储条目时,可以通过下面的接口将其移除:
cc.sys.localStorage.removeItem(key)
//移除所有储存数据
cc.sys.localStorage.clear()
本文介绍如何使用cc.sys.localStorage进行数据的存储、读取与删除。包括将复杂数据转化为JSON格式进行存储的方法,以及如何从存储中获取并解析JSON数据为原始对象。此外还介绍了如何移除特定键值对及清空所有存储。
524

被折叠的 条评论
为什么被折叠?



